Abstract

The invention discloses a heald lifting device on a rapier loom, wherein a weft detector used for detecting whether wefts are led in or not is arranged on the rapier loom. The heald lifting device comprises a heald lifting cutter at the head end or the tail end and also comprises a proximity switch which is arranged nearby the heald lifting cutter and only used for detecting the moving position of the heald lifting cutter, wherein the proximity switch communicates with the weft detector. When empty weft appears, the first heald lifting cutter moves to a position close to the proximity switch, the proximity switch sends a signal to the weft detector, the weft detector sends a yarn signal to an electrical cabinet and the whole machine rotates continuously and does not stop. The device can be used on an occasion when patterns on a cloth require local empty weft; and the rapier loom with the device has relatively strong adaptive capacity.

Description

Heald lifting device on the Rapier looms
Technical field
The present invention relates to a kind of heald lifting device that is applied on the Rapier looms.
Background technology
In the prior art, Rapier looms has and is used to detect the weft detector that whether has weft yarn to introduce, when empty latitude occurring, weft detector can send a no yarn signal to the main controller of complete machine, the complete machine automatic stopping, complete machine does not stop when existing some demands to require empty latitude in practice, requires local empty latitude as the floral designs on the cloth, then existing Rapier looms can't adapt to this demand, and adaptive capacity is poor.
Summary of the invention
The object of the present invention is to provide a kind of heald lifting device that is applied on the Rapier looms, this device makes that complete machine does not stop when having leisure latitude.
In order to reach above purpose, the technical solution used in the present invention is: the heald lifting device on a kind of Rapier looms, have on the Rapier looms and be used to detect the weft detector that whether has weft yarn to introduce, this heald lifting device comprises a slice shedding cutter that is in head-end location or tail end position, it also comprise be located near this sheet shedding cutter and only be used to detect this sheet shedding cutter movement position near switch, describedly communicate near switch and described weft detector.
Because the present invention has adopted above technical scheme, its advantage is: when empty latitude occurring, first shedding cutter moves near the position near switch, then send a signal and give weft detector near switch, the control weft detector sends one has the yarn signal to give electric cabinet, and then complete machine remains in operation, and can not stop, this device can be useful in the situation that floral designs on the cloth require local empty latitude, and the Rapier looms adaptive capacity with this device is stronger.

The specific embodiment
Further set forth concrete structure of the present invention below in conjunction with accompanying drawing.
Shown in accompanying drawing 1, a kind of Rapier looms comprises warp-feeding mechanism, shedding mechanism, weft insertion device, beating-up mechanism, spooler, during work, electric cabinet 4 is coordinated each mechanism of control makes it come work by certain kind of drive and transmission ratios, guarantees normal woven carrying out.
Have on the Rapier looms and be used to detect the weft detector 2 that whether has weft yarn to introduce, weft detector 2 communicates with electric cabinet 4, and when empty latitude occurring, weft yarn detects 2 can send no a yarn signal to electric cabinet 4, electric cabinet 4 control complete machines parkings.
Has multi-disc shedding cutter 5 on the Rapier looms, heald lifting device on the Rapier looms comprises a slice shedding cutter 5 of being in head-end location, be located near this sheet shedding cutter 5 and only be used to detect these sheet shedding cutter 5 movement positions near switch 6, communicate by cable 12 near switch 6 and weft detector 2.Near switch 6 are infrared sensors, when first shedding cutter 5 near near switch 6 time, can output one signal near switch 6, near the position of the switch 6 shedding cutter 5 away from other sheets, the motion of the shedding cutter 5 of other sheets can not influence near switch 6.Also can only detect the motion of a slice shedding cutter 5 that is in the tail end position near switch 6, and not be subjected to the influence of other shedding cuttves 5.When empty latitude occurring, move near position corresponding to first shedding cutter 5 near switch 6, then send a signal and give weft detector 2 near switch 6, control weft detector 2 sends one has the yarn signal to give electric cabinet 4, then complete machine remains in operation, can not stop, this device can be useful in the situation that floral designs on the cloth require local empty latitude.
